Understanding the Remember Me Mechanism
The “Remember Me” function on the Duffspin website works by storing a secure token or cookie directly on your device. When you check this box during login, the system bypasses the standard authentication process for a predetermined period — often several weeks or until you explicitly log out or clear your browser data. This eliminates the need to re-enter your username and password repeatedly, creating a seamless entry point. For many users, this is a hallmark of user-centric design, as it speeds up recurring visits. However, it relies heavily on the assumption that your device remains under your exclusive control. The Duffspin platform implements this feature with standard industry practices, but the ultimate security of the session token depends on the integrity of your personal device and browsing habits.

Privacy and Security Considerations
Despite the convenience, the “Remember Me” option introduces specific risks that cannot be ignored. The most significant danger occurs on shared or public computers, where a forgotten active session could expose your account to the next user. If a device is lost or stolen, an active “Remember Me” token can grant the finder instant access to your account without needing any passwords. Additionally, stored cookies can be vulnerable to certain types of cyberattacks such as cross-site scripting or session hijacking if the device is compromised by malware. It is also worth noting that browser-level caching may leave traces of your activity, which could be viewed by anyone with physical access to your machine. Therefore, weighing the trade-off between ease and safety is crucial before enabling this feature.
Best Practices for Safe Usage
To enjoy the convenience of the “Remember Me” option while keeping your Duffspin account secure, follow a few simple but effective guidelines. First, only use the feature on devices that are exclusively yours and that you trust fully. Second, ensure your operating system, browser, and antivirus software are kept up to date to minimize vulnerabilities. Third, enable two-factor authentication on your Duffspin account if the platform offers it, as this adds an extra layer of protection even if your session token is compromised. Fourth, regularly clear your saved sessions and cookies, especially after using a device that others may access. Finally, always log out manually when you are finished using a shared or borrowed device. By adopting these habits, you can significantly reduce the risk associated with persistent login features.
